Simulation-based reinforcement learning for real-world autonomous
driving
IEEE International Conference on Robotics and Automation (ICRA), 2019
Abstract
We use synthetic data and a reinforcement learning algorithm to train a system controlling a full-size real-world vehicle in a number of restricted driving scenarios. The driving policy uses RGB images as input. We analyze how design decisions about perception, control and training impact the real-world performance.
